Dr. William Stixrud and Ned Johnson, bestselling authors of The Self-Driven Child, will offer a preview of their new book, What Do You Say? Talking with Kids to Build Motivation, Stress Tolerance, and a Happy Home (available in the late summer of 2021).
Informed by research, this talk will emphasize practical communication strategies for building a strong emotional connection with our kids, communicating healthy (versus toxic) expectations, fostering intrinsic motivation, and helping kids find their own reasons to change when they’re struggling.
